Brazo Río Achiguate
Brazo Río Achiguate is a distributary in Escuintla Department, Guatemala. Brazo Río Achiguate is situated nearby to the village Chulamar, as well as near the locality Barrita Vieja.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Puerto San José, also known as Port of San José, is a town on Guatemala's Pacific Ocean coast, in the department of Escuintla. It has a population of 23,887, making it the largest town on the nation's Pacific coast.
